Acceptance

Acceptance is unnecessary to engage with when one is at peace.

In order to accept, there must be something to resist. One cannot exist without the other.

Do you accept the air, the grass, the existence of your hand? No, for you do not resist their presence.

All things simply “are”. Only the mind sees exclusions; things that “should not” be.

“That person is not recycling and they should be”, says the ego. It might as well be saying “That grass is not blue and it should be”, for the statement is just as fantastical.

Recycle or don’t recycle. Each choice has its consequences, as does the choice to be, or not be, in a state of peace with someone who doesn’t recycle.

Notice when the mind comments upon, labels, judges, compares or needs to understand “what is”. Recognise how noisy this is. See how the mind overlays “reality” with narrative. Then, you are aware. You are at peace. There is no need for acceptance.
